- 发行说明
- 在开始之前
- 入门指南
- 集成
- 使用流程应用程序
- 创建应用程序
- 正在加载数据
- 自定义流程应用程序
- 应用程序模板
- 其他资源
- 开箱即用标签和截止日期
- 在本地环境中编辑数据转换
- Setting up a local test environment
- Designing an event log
- 扩展 SAP Ariba 提取工具
- 性能特征
- Basic troubleshooting guide
Basic troubleshooting guide
此故障排除页面旨在作为使用UiPath™ Process Mining时遇到常见问题或提出问题的知识库。 它不会提供您可能遇到的所有问题的完整列表,但旨在提供有关最常见问题的指导。 如果您遇到此处未涵盖的任何问题,请随时联系 UiPath™ 技术支持。
本节介绍在提取失败的情况下,如何手动停止从数据库运行的数据。
请执行以下步骤:
-
检索要取消其数据运行的流程应用程序的应用程序 ID。 请参阅流程应用程序属性。
-
请与数据库管理员联系,以在AutomationSuite_ProcessMining_Metadata数据库中运行以下 SQL 查询:
with Ingestion_tbl as (select top 1 * from dbo.Ingestions where AppId = '<app ID>' and [Status] = 1 order by LastUpdated desc) update Ingestion_tbl set [Status]=3
,其中 <app ID> 应替换为在步骤 1 中检索到的应用程序 ID。有关示例,请参见下图。 -
刷新“Process Mining 门户”页面。
-
上传流程应用程序的数据。
AutomationSuite_ProcessMining_Metadata
。 如果您的组织策略或防火墙规则不允许使用端口 1433,则可以将定向到 SQL Server IP 地址的端口 1433 的传入流量重定向到新的 SQL Server IP 和端口。
nat
规则:
iptables -t nat -A PREROUTING -d <sql server IP> -dport 1433 -j DNAT --to-destination <sql server ip>:<sql server port>
iptables -t nat -A PREROUTING -d <sql server IP> -dport 1433 -j DNAT --to-destination <sql server ip>:<sql server port>
<sql server IP>
和<sql server port>
替换为您各自的 SQL Server IP 地址和端口号。
此命令应以 root 用户或 sudo 用户身份运行。
确保配置流程应用程序的安全性。 请参阅配置流程应用程序安全性。
app_security_mode
从system_managed
更改为single_account
。
Message: [Errno 2] No such file or directory: '/dbt/dags/workflows/execdbt//target/4212eba4-1edc-4b9c-9c04-1d59c2bfe0af/run_results.json'
enableSqlIntegratedAuth
配置标志决定是否将集成 SQL 身份验证设置用于 SQL 身份验证。 如果enableSqlIntegratedAuth
配置标志设置为true ,这意味着不将 Kerberos 设置用于身份验证。 要解决此问题, enableSqlIntegratedAuth
配置标志必须设置为false ,这将禁用集成 SQL 身份验证并确保使用 Kerberos 设置进行身份验证。
更改查询并运行文件后,可能会出现“预览”不变的情况。
可能的原因
sql
文件与dbt
中的文件相同,因为它自上次运行以来尚未更新。 如果再次运行文件,则不会检测到任何更改,因此不会更新预览表。 例如,如果您添加WHERE
条件并运行文件,则“预览”将仅显示筛选后的记录。 但是,如果您删除此WHERE
条件并再次运行文件,则“预览”仍将仅显示先前筛选的记录,而实际上应显示所有记录。
解决方案
SQL
文件中添加或更改注释。 这将强制dbt
运行,并且预览版将更新。
可能的原因
您上传的一个或多个输入文件包含意外的编码。
解决方案
Set the encoding to UTF-8 and set CR/LF end of line characters (Windows style).
您可以在文件编辑器中更改这些设置。 例如,在 Notepad++ 中。
1. 在 Notepad++ 中打开数据源文件。
2. 转到“ 编辑”->“EOL 转换 ”,然后选择“ Windows CR LF”。
3. 转到“ 编码 ”,然后选择“ 转换为 UTF-8”。
4. 保存文件。
可能的原因
HTTPS 证书不正确或缺失。
解决方案
BLOB 存储使用的 HTTPS 证书必须在浏览器中有效。 检查错误,并确保获取相应的证书。
1. 转到 Process Mining 门户,然后按 F12 打开 Developer 工具。
使用示例数据创建新的流程应用程序时,可能会出现以下错误消息:
可能的原因
SQL Server 密码已更改。配置 Microsoft SQL Server。
解决方案
更改 SQL Server 凭据时更新 Automation Suite。
- 简介
- 如何从数据库取消数据运行
- 如何添加 IP 表格规则以使用 SQL Server 端口 1433
- 创建流程应用程序时,状态停留在“正在创建应用程序”
- 可能的原因
- 解决方案
- Message: [Errno 2] No such file or directory: '/dbt/dags/workflows/execdbt//target/4212eba4-1edc-4b9c-9c04-1d59c2bfe0af/run_results.json'
- 可能的原因
- 解决方案
- 可能的原因
- 可能的解决方案
- 数据转换
- 更改查询后预览未更改
- 消息:选择条件与任何节点都不匹配。 无需执行任何操作。
- 上传数据
- Message: utf-8 codec can't decode byte <byte> in position <position>: Invalid start byte
- 消息:由于以下错误,文件上传失败: 网络错误
- Message: The HTTP status code of the response was not expected (500)
- CData 同步
- 连接错误: 与主机 <host>、端口 <port> 的 TCP/IP 连接失败。